昆虫般大小的机器人

    ①一部分研制机器人的专家认为:下一步的研究方向主要是机器人的大小,未来机器人的大小应该和昆虫相仿。

    ②大型机器人需要沉重昂贵的发动机和大量的动力消耗,需要接合的手臂和数千米的连线。控制所有这些硬件又需要数平方英寸的微晶片。而如果机器人的这些部件组装起来只有昆虫那样大小,那么它的造价不但会便宜得多,它所能从事的工作也会给人类生存带来很大影响。

    ③一般说来,目前机器人所能做的工作都可由相应的机器来取代。与工厂中固定的有强大动力的机器相比,许多工作由机器人来做不如留给相应的机器去做。但是小机器人所能做的工作却不是机器所能完成的,这正如微型飞机比大型飞机更适合用来观测农场作物的生长情况以及控制自动灌溉和施肥系统一样。比如只有微型机器人,才能沿着患者的血管,进入变窄了的冠状动脉去排除血管壁上沉淀的胆固醇,从而解除病人的危险。

    ④当然,就目前的情况来看,这种说法未免言过其实。不过研究人员确已成功设计出一种能进入煤气或自来水管道去修补裂缝或漏洞的微型机器人。这种机器人进入管道之后,可用自己的身体测量经过地方的电导,一旦测不到这种电导,就表明那里存在着裂缝或漏洞。于是该机器人便作出“自我牺牲”,用自己的身体来把裂缝或漏洞堵上。

    ⑤如果许多这样的微型机器人通力合作,其功用更是一般机械所无法比拟的了。比如说战场上可使用微型机器人兵士。这些“兵士”可轻易地偷偷爬过或飞过战场,而不被敌方的雷达系统发现,因为它们体积微小,且可超低空飞行(乘微型火箭).一旦越过敌人的防线,它们便可成为摧毁敌方设施的生力军,就像毁掉农作物的蝗虫一样。

    ⑥这种昆虫般大小的机器人目前已不再是科幻小说里的主人公。当然要它们在现实生活中出现,还需克服一系列技术上的障碍。其中主要是如何把现在机器人所用的齿轮、杠杆、曲柄、弹簧和其它机械部件缩小到比头发丝还细的程度,同时把传感器、电动机、控制计算机及其他系统装配到一块微晶片上。

    ⑦当然目前制作微型动力部件的技术还处于刚刚研制阶段。1988年初加利福尼亚大学伯克利分校的一个实验室的工作人员,制造出了只有1/5毫米长的带连接部件的曲柄和齿轮。这种齿轮的轮只有红细胞一般大小。新泽西州美国电报电话公司贝尔实验室的专家们已经研制出了比蚂蚱颚还要小的钳子。该实验室还研制出了只有半毫米大小每分钟24000转的气功涡轮机,其转速比许多喷气式飞机的发动机还要快。机器人微型化的另一个问题是动力问题。为微型机器人提供动力的装置要比电池小非常多才行。不过,微型发动机的研制工作也取得了令人鼓舞的进展。

    ⑧微型机器人的大量生产恐怕还不是近年之内能办到的事情。然而,一旦这种机器人能批量生产出来,它们在科研和生产中所起的作用将是无法估量的。

    The Leaning Tower of Pisa was straight like a pole when the construction began in 1173. It started to shift direction soon after construction because of poor foundation in addition to the loose layer of subsoil(底土). At the beginning, it leaned to the southeast before the shaky foundation started to shift leaning towards the southwest. After the period of structural strengthening at the beginning of the 21st century, now the Leaning Tower of Pisa leans at an angle of 3.97 degrees.

    In 1178, the shift in direction was observed for the first time when the construction had progressed further to the third floor. The tower was heavy for the three-meter foundation that was built on a weak area of land.

    For compensating(补偿) the leaning position, the builders started to construct the upper floors with one side higher than the other one. This caused the tower to lean in the other direction. This unusual structure led to the tower being actually curved. In spite of these efforts, the tower kept on leaning.

    The government of Italy started to plan prevention of the complete collapse of the tower in 1964. However, a request was put forward by the authorities to keep the leaning position because of the tourism industry of the region.

    After nearly two decades of careful planning by engineers, historians and mathematicians, the stabilization efforts for the Leaning Tower of Pisa started in 1990. The tower was closed for the general public and the people living nearby moved away. For reducing the total weight of the tower, its seven bells which represented the seven musical notes were removed. The tower was reopened for the general public on December 15, 2001.

    In May 2008, after removing another 70 metric tons of earth, the engineers announced that the tower had been finally stabilized and it would remain stable for at least 200 years.
